Lush victory over Amazon puts search terms back in the spotlight

In December, WTR asked whether AdWord disputes could be back on the litigation agenda after UK cosmetics company Lush took Amazon to the High Court of England and Wales, claiming trademark infringement in a dispute centred on search terms. While this week’s decision in the case was fact-specific, it offers some important guidance on online advertising practices and could impact how retailers use related trademarks in instances where they don’t actually stock a particular brand.
